About the role
Responsibilities
- Lead, coach, and support staff including onboarding and cultivating team culture
- Engage and support families through clear communication and relationship building
- Ensure program excellence by leading daily operations and facilitating team meetings
- Respond to student needs and manage escalated behaviors with wisdom
- Communicate and collaborate with the Area Director regarding site-level goals
